Cardinals-Panthers Lines Preview

The fans at Bank of America Stadium will be treated to a Divisional Round game between the Arizona Cardinals and the Carolina Panthers when they take their seats on Saturday night.
Oddsmakers currently have the Panthers listed as 10-point favorites versus the Cardinals, while the game’s total is sitting at 49.
Kurt Warner threw two touchdown passes, including a 71-yarder to Anquan Boldin, as the Cardinals defeated the Falcons 30-24 in their Wild Card game last time out. The Cardinals covered the 2-point spread, and the 54 points made it OVER the posted total of 52.
Warner completed 19-of-32 pass attempts for 271 yards, and Larry Fitzgerald had 101 yards receiving with a TD in that win.
The Panthers defeated New Orleans 33-31 as a 1.5-point favorite in Week 17. The combined score went OVER the posted over/under total (51.5)
DeAngelo Williams rushed for 178 yards on 25 carries for Carolina, while Jake Delhomme passed for 250 yards with a touchdown in the win.

Ravens-Titans Odds Preview

The Baltimore Ravens and the Tennessee Titans will both be trying to pick up a win on Saturday afternoon when they battle at LP Field in the Divisional Round of the NFL playoffs.
Oddsmakers currently have the Titans listed as 3-point favorites versus the Ravens, while the game’s total is sitting at 34½.
The Ravens defeated Miami 27-9 as a 3.5-point favorite in the Wild Card round last week. The combined score fell UNDER the posted over/under total (38).
Le’Ron McClain rushed for 71 yards and a touchdown on 19 carries for Baltimore, while Ed Reed made a pair of interceptions and returned one for a touchdown in the win.
The Titans lost to Indianapolis 23-0 as a 3-point favorite in Week 17. The combined score fell UNDER the posted over/under total (39.5).
Vince Young threw for 55 yards with no touchdowns and no interceptions for Tennessee and LenDale White rushed for 25 yards on seven carries.

Charlotte-Philadelphia Lines Preview

The Charlotte Bobcats and the Philadelphia 76ers will both be trying to pick up a win on Friday when they battle at Wachovia Center.
Oddsmakers currently have the 76ers listed as 5½-point favorites versus the Bobcats, while the game’s total has not yet been posted.
The Bobcats got down early and were crushed 111-81 by the Cavaliers last time out, as 14-point road underdogs. That game’s 192 points made it OVER the posted total of 182.5.
Boris Diaw netted 10 points with eight rebounds and six assists in the loss.
The 76ers outscored the Bucks by 11 points in the fourth quarter and came away with a 110-105 victory on Wednesday, as 7.5-point underdogs. That game’s combined 215 points sailed OVER the posted total of 195.5.
Andre Miller led the way with a game-high 28 points with nine rebounds, and Andre Iguodala added 20 points in the win.

Memphis-Toronto Lines Preview

The Memphis Grizzlies and the Toronto Raptors will both be gunning for a victory on Friday when they meet at Air Canada Centre.
Odds aren’t yet posted for this game, so check back later for the opening line and total.
The Grizzlies were outplayed early on and could not recover in a 100-89 loss to the Nets on Wednesday, as 4.5-point road underdogs. That game’s 189 points made it OVER the posted total of 187.
O.J. Mayo netted a game-high 26 points for the Grizzlies, and Rudy Gay had 23 in the loss.
The Raptors won their third game in four outings with a 99-93 win over the Wizards on Wednesday, as 2.5-point underdogs. That game’s combined 192 points went as a PUSH against the posted total of 192.
Andrea Bargnani shot 8-for-9 from the field with 25 points and four rebounds to lead the way. Chris Bosh chipped in with 18 points and eight rebounds in the win.

Mavericks-Suns Lines Preview

The Dallas Mavericks and the Phoenix Suns will both be trying to pick up a win on Friday when they battle at US Airways Center.
Odds aren’t yet posted for this game, so check back later for the opening line and total.
The Mavericks rallied in the second half to pull out a hard-fought 99-94 win over the Knicks on Thursday. The Mavericks failed to cover the 8-point spread, and the 193 points went UNDER the posted total of 213.
Jason Kidd shot 6-for-15 from the field with 16 points, seven rebounds and four assists.
The Suns were upset 113-110 by the Pacers last time out, as 9.5-point favorites at home. That game’s 223 points fell UNDER the night’s posted total of 226.
Amare Stoudemire scored a team-high 23 points, while Steve Nash added 16 points with four rebounds and 12 assists in the loss.

Celtics-Cavaliers Odds Preview

The Boston Celtics and the Cleveland Cavaliers will both be gunning for a victory on Friday when they meet at Quicken Loans Arena.
Oddsmakers currently have the Cavaliers listed as 4-point favorites versus the Celtics, while the game’s total has not yet been posted.
The Celtics were upset 89-85 by the Rockets last time out, as 10-point favorites at home. The game’s 174 points went UNDER the posted total of 184.5.
Paul Pierce had 26 points with five rebounds and four assists in that loss.
The Cavaliers settled the Bobcats down early as they cruised to a 111-81 victory on Wednesday. The Cavaliers easily covered the 14-point spread, and the 192 points made it OVER the posted total of 182.5.
LeBron James led the way with 21 points, four rebounds and four assists. Mo Williams, Wally Szczerbiak, and Daniel Gibson had 15 points apiece in that win.
